Output 1115f10cc75ba02892e499dd081a8bf687563c7738e38f37a0202720bf23cdfa:0

value
13919196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d786660bdc41f3322c27a89d90bdebd56a9b97f OP_EQUAL
address
3Mt3VUGUiBiqA6uBHiccqFKPrQq7LEMNhA
transaction
1115f10cc75ba02892e499dd081a8bf687563c7738e38f37a0202720bf23cdfa
confirmations
153962
spent
true